
leetcode
文章平均质量分 67
奔跑 の蜗牛
这个作者很懒,什么都没留下…
展开
-
LeetCode链表问题总结
在力扣中单链表的定义为:struct ListNode{ int val; ListNode *next; ListNode():val(x),next(nullptr) {} ListNode(int x):val(x),next(nullptr) {} ListNode(int x,ListNode *next):val(x),next(next) {}}203. 移除链表元素移除链表中的某一个元素,只需遍历这个链表,如果这个结点的下一个结点的值等原创 2022-09-04 19:24:55 · 607 阅读 · 0 评论 -
哈希表的使用
哈希表一般用于存储键值对即key-val一般是由数组和链表构成常用操作//查找是否存在键值unordered_map<int,int> hash;hash.find(key)==hash.end();hash.count(key)==1;例题290. Word Pattern由于C++中的哈希表不能查找某一值的存在,只能查找某一键是否存在,所以C++需要两个哈希表来相互存储。class Solution {public: //将字符串传入到数组原创 2021-07-27 22:29:07 · 2411 阅读 · 0 评论